What It Is

VR Coaster delivers the experience of a full-scale amusement park ride inside your venue. Four guests strap into a fully enclosed motion simulator, put on 3D VR goggles, and are launched into an immersive world of loops, drops, and high-speed thrills. The difference from a headset-only VR game is the hydraulic motion seating: the platform physically moves in sync with what guests see, so the body feels every twist and turn the goggles show.

The combination of real motion, surround sound, and full visual immersion is what makes it unforgettable rather than just fun. Guests do not watch a coaster, they ride one. The enclosed platform and synced motion sell the illusion completely, and the reactions inside are genuine: real screams, real white-knuckle grips, real laughter when the goggles come off.

An external screen displays the ride to everyone outside, which turns the experience into a spectacle. Onlookers watch the screen, watch the riders react, and queue up for their turn, so the ride is a crowd magnet even for the people not on it yet. How is the VR Coaster different from a regular VR game?

The VR Coaster pairs the 3D goggles with hydraulic motion seating, so the platform physically moves in sync with what riders see. Instead of just watching a coaster through a headset, guests feel every loop, drop, and turn in their body. That real motion is what makes it an unforgettable ride rather than a screen experience.

How many people can ride at once?

The fully enclosed platform seats four guests per ride cycle. Group seating lets friends experience the ride together, which keeps the energy and reactions high. Our attendant manages the queue to keep the cycles moving and wait times short.

Can spectators see what riders are experiencing?

Yes. An external screen displays the ride to everyone outside, so onlookers watch the action and the riders react in real time. The spectator screen turns the experience into a crowd magnet and keeps a queue forming for the next turn.

What does the VR Coaster need at the venue?

The ride needs a clear footprint for the enclosed motion platform plus the spectator screen and operator area, standard power, and secure Wi-Fi for optimal performance. We assess your venue during booking and confirm placement and requirements before the event.
